Sea Freight from Guangzhou/Shenzhen, China to Sao Jose dos Pinhais, Brazil: 20FT/40FT FCL and LCL Options
1. Full Container Load (FCL) Shipping
Full Container Load (FCL) is the most straightforward shipping option when you have enough goods to fill an entire container. For larger volumes, shipping an entire 20FT or 40FT container from Guangzhou or Shenzhen to Sao Jose dos Pinhais offers cost efficiency and a more streamlined process. These containers are loaded, sealed, and sent directly to the destination port.
20FT and 40FT Container Options: A 20FT container can typically hold 28-30 cubic meters of cargo, while a 40FT container holds about 56-58 cubic meters. Depending on the size of your shipment, you can choose the appropriate container size for your goods.
CIF (Cost, Insurance, Freight): The CIF shipping term covers the cost of transportation, including insurance and freight, until the goods reach the port of destination. In this case, it refers to the delivery from Guangzhou or Shenzhen to the port of Sao Jose dos Pinhais.

2. Less-than-Container Load (LCL) Shipping
If your shipment volume is smaller and doesn’t justify a full container, LCL is the perfect alternative. LCL allows you to share a container with other shippers, reducing the overall cost by consolidating multiple shipments into one container.
Consolidation and Transit Time: LCL shipments from Guangzhou or Shenzhen to Sao Jose dos Pinhais will be consolidated at the port before being shipped, with transit time typically around 35 days. Since LCL involves multiple shippers, it can take a bit longer for the cargo to be loaded, unloaded, and delivered.
Customs Clearance and Delivery: Once the goods arrive at Sao Jose dos Pinhais, they go through customs clearance before being sent to the final destination. The LCL option also ensures that the cargo is transported directly from the port to the consignee’s location in Brazil.

3. Packaging Requirements
Proper packaging is essential for the safe transportation of your goods from China to Brazil. Whether shipping FCL or LCL, the packaging should ensure that the items are protected from potential damage during transit.
For FCL Shipping: In a full container load, the cargo will be placed directly in the container, and it is crucial to secure the goods to prevent shifting during transit. Cargo can be packed in pallets or crates, and plastic wrapping or stretch film is commonly used for additional protection. For sensitive items, wooden crates and boxes may be required to provide extra stability.
For LCL Shipping: Since your goods will be consolidated with other shipments, it is important to ensure that your cargo is well-packaged to avoid damage and leakage. Wooden pallets or strong cardboard boxes are typical for LCL cargo. It is advisable to use shrink-wrap or heavy-duty plastic for waterproofing and securing smaller items. Labeling is also critical to ensure accurate identification during the handling process.
4. Transit Time
Shipping from Guangzhou or Shenzhen to Sao Jose dos Pinhais typically takes about 35 days by sea. This timeframe can vary slightly based on port conditions and customs processing times at both the departure and destination ports. It’s important to plan for potential delays, especially when shipping under LCL terms, as consolidation and deconsolidation processes may extend the overall transit time.
